The PlanBarometer project, initially known as the white paper on planning, emerged from resolution CRP/XV/01 of the Regional Council for Planning (CRP) of the Latin American and Caribbean Institute for Economic and Social Planning (ILPES) at its fifteenth meeting in Yachay (Ecuador) on 19 November 2015. ILPES took on the task of creating a guide on good practices in national, subnational and sectoral planning processes that incorporates instruments, approaches and methodologies for finance modelling in development planning and planning processes, particularly those linked to the 2030 Agenda
